![]() ![]() |
Post
#1
|
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 27.03.2003 Ostrzeżenie: (0%)
|
Czy istnieja gotowe funkcje/rozwiazania mysql/php sluzace do transponowania danych? Jesli TAK - prosze o namiary, jesli NIE - poradze sobie ;-). Zakladam, ze byc moze istnieja gotowe, wydajne i proste metody.
(IMG:http://forum.php.pl/style_emoticons/default/questionmark.gif) ? |
|
|
|
Post
#2
|
|
|
Grupa: Przyjaciele php.pl Postów: 398 Pomógł: 0 Dołączył: -- Skąd: Poznań Ostrzeżenie: (0%)
|
Transponowania? Może kolega rozwinąć temat?
Transponowanie kojarzy mi się wyłącznie z macierzami, więc nie bardzo rozumiem pytanie... |
|
|
|
Post
#3
|
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 27.03.2003 Ostrzeżenie: (0%)
|
dragossani/ i dobrze Ci sie kojarzy ;-]
Chodzi o zamiane ukladu danych wyciagnietych kwerenda z tabeli: wiersze -> kolumny. Przykl. wynik query: A, 1 B, 2 C, 3 Po transponowaniu: A, B, C 1, 2, 3 Najlepiej, by operacja wykonywana byla po stronie mysql. |
|
|
|
Post
#4
|
|
|
Grupa: Przyjaciele php.pl Postów: 398 Pomógł: 0 Dołączył: -- Skąd: Poznań Ostrzeżenie: (0%)
|
Lekko nie będzie. Nie słyszałem żeby MySQL miał tego typu operacje wbudowane. Przeszukałem sieć pod tym kątem i wygląda na to, że Postgres też tego nie ma. Nie wiem jak Oracle (jeżeli w ogóle to tylko ta baza może coś takiego mieć) bo słabo znam.
Po stronie php nie powinieneś mieć z tym problemu. Co prawda nie ma chyba gotowej funkcji ale sprawa nie wydaje się skomplikowana. Spróbuj napisać funkcję do tego. Jak by Ci nie szło to daj znać. |
|
|
|
Post
#5
|
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 27.03.2003 Ostrzeżenie: (0%)
|
ja tez nie slyszalem i siec przeszukalem ((IMG:http://forum.php.pl/style_emoticons/default/questionmark.gif) ?!!!). W php sie zrobi - myslalem, ze moze istnieje gotowe, wydajne rozw. Thx.
|
|
|
|
![]() ![]() |
|
Aktualny czas: 22.12.2025 - 23:46 |